An outdoor, daytime photograph displays a large, ornate archway serving as an entrance in Quy Nhon Ward, Vietnam, beneath a partly cloudy blue sky. The archway is constructed from light beige material with gold decorative elements and Vietnamese text. The central arch features the prominent gold Vietnamese inscription "THƯỢNG LẠC." Above the arch on the right, partial gold text reads "PHÁP ĐẢO 141 TRẦN" alongside a circular Buddhist Dharma wheel symbol. The archway's pillars are adorned with vertical columns of gold Vietnamese characters. The left pillar is topped with a multi-tiered, pagoda-style ornament. A black security camera is mounted on the upper section of the left pillar, facing towards the exterior. Two reddish-brown metal gates, each featuring a circular Dharma wheel design, are open: the left gate is partially open inwards, and the right gate is partially open outwards. Utility lines are visible traversing the sky above and through the archway. Beyond the archway, an asphalt street is visible. Across the street, a multi-story, light-colored building with multiple dark-framed windows stands, partially fronted by a fenced area with a green awning. No individuals are clearly visible.
